Insurance and optional extras
Car rental excess insurance isn't mandatory, but is something to think about. If you're in a collision, no matter how minor, it can help you avoid paying an expensive excess fee. Different Cody / Yellowstone car hire providers have varying insurance policies and cover levels, so check the details before booking.

Good to know
To rent a vehicle in the United States, you typically have to be at least 21 years old. Some companies may rent vehicles to younger drivers at an extra cost, so always go over the policies before locking in your reservation.
Add a car seat to your Cody / Yellowstone car hire reservation if you're travelling with small kids. Regulations change from one place to another, but using a child seat suited to their age, weight and size is always the safest approach.
Come prepared to avoid delays at pick-up. You'll typically need your physical driver's licence (no screenshots) and another form of photo ID. Also keep a credit card handy to cover the required excess. If extra requirements apply, your booking will list them.
Driving in the United States might take some adjustment for first-time visitors. Don't forget all vehicles travel on the right side of the road.
Stay within local speed limits of about 40kph through built-up areas and around 110kph on highways. Road signs will indicate if the limit is different.
In the United States, the legal blood alcohol concentration (BAC) limit is 0.08%. If you intend to have a couple of drinks, leave the driving to someone else or arrange a taxi or ride-share instead.
